As a Data Center Inventory & Asset Technician (DIAT) at Microsoft, you will play a crucial role in managing inventory and asset logistics within the data center environment. This position involves performing cycle audits, handling incoming and outgoing deliveries, coordinating security for third-party vendors, and documenting all transactions as per management instructions. You will also engage in warranty claims and process returns for failed equipment, contributing to the overall efficiency and effectiveness of Microsoft's cloud operations.

  • Perform cycle audits and data corrections to ensure inventory controls are met.
  • Execute incoming and outgoing deliveries as instructed by management.
  • Document inbound and outbound packages accurately.
  • Coordinate security escorts for third-party vendors.
  • Engage in Task Hazard Analysis (THA) for every task performed.
  • Maintain focus on customer service and understand the impact of work on stakeholders.
  • Develop working knowledge of stock control and inventory management practices.
  • Initiate warranty claims and process returns for failed equipment.
  • Perform destruction of data bearing devices (DBD) following Microsoft policies.
  • Notify management about stock shortages and escalate issues as necessary.
  • High School Diploma AND 6 months experience or an internship in inventory management, retail, warehouse management, or a related field OR equivalent experience.
  • Ability to meet Microsoft, customer and/or government security screening requirements.
  • 1+ year(s) experience in warehouse/supply chain in an IT environment or logistics.
  • Experience operating heavy-load movement equipment (e.g., forklift, pallet jacks).
